Distance between Champaign and St. Louis
Distance from Champaign, IL to St. Louis, MO is 147 miles / 236 kilometers.
Map showing the distance from Champaign to St. Louis
Air distance: | miles km |
Champaign, IL
City: | Champaign, IL |
Country: | United States |
Coordinates: |
40°6′59″N 88°14′36″W |
St. Louis, MO
City: | St. Louis, MO |
Country: | United States |
Coordinates: |
38°37′38″N 90°11′52″W |
Time difference between Champaign and St. Louis
There is no time difference between Champaign and St. Louis. Current local time in Champaign and St. Louis is 13:05 CST (2024-11-22)